Beowulf Slays Box Office Competition As Weekend's Top Movie
Sunday November 18, 2007
CityNews.ca Staff
"Beowulf" ridded a Danish kingdom of a massive beast named Grendel, and was rewarded with a $28.1 million debut weekend and the top spot at the box office.
The animated telling met with little competition, getting a nice boost with 40 per cent of sales coming from special 3-D showings.
1. "Beowulf," $28.1 million.
2. "Bee Movie," $14.3 million.
3. "American Gangster," $13.2 million.
4. "Fred Claus," $12 million.
5. "Mr. Magorium's Wonder Emporium," $10 million.
6. "Dan in Real Life," $4.5 million.
7. "No Country for Old Men," $3 million.
8. "Lions for Lambs," $3 million.
9. "Saw IV," $2.3 million.
10. "Love in the Time of Cholera," $1.9 million.
